International Open Access Week is a global, community-driven week of action to open up access to research. The event is celebrated by individuals, institutions and organizations across the world, and its organization is led by a global advisory committee. At FEMS, we are currently developing two new fully open access journals to add to our current portfolio. FEMS Microbes and microLife, will be our first fully Open Access titles and, as with all of our publications, will adopt the highest scientific and publishing standards.

With this and other initiatives, we will continue to serve the European and worldwide community of microbiologists by providing a range of publishing options, including Open Access options. We continue to reinvest our publishing income into science and the promotion of microbiology at all levels.
